%20no%20Excel%202010.png)
Estou usando o Excel 2010 e tenho várias células que contêm *10^9, por exemplo, 5*10^9, 3,4*10^9 e preciso remover *10^9. Dado que existem cerca de 50.000 entradas, não quero fazer isso manualmente, mas não sou muito experiente com o Excel e não tenho certeza de como fazer isso. Tentei usar a função localizar e substituir, mas quando fiz isso, ele removeu todo o conteúdo da célula onde desejo manter o número anterior a * 10 ^ 9. Tenho certeza de que deve haver uma maneira de fazer isso, mas não sei como! Alguma idéia ou dica?
Responder1
Quando você usa um asterisco *
em uma localização do Excel, significa "corresponder a qualquer sequência de caracteres". Então
*10^9
significa combinar a célula inteira até *10^9. Então quando você substitui, ele substitui tudo.
Para significar um literal, *
você precisa escapar dele com um til:
~*10^9
Isso significa corresponder à parte da célula que começa contendo apenas *10^9
. Você pode então deixar o campo de substituição em branco e isso será removido das células.
Responder2
O problema é o caractere *, que é tratado como curinga. Para impedir que isso aconteça, preceda-o pelo caractere ~.
Em outras palavras, procure por "~*10^9" e substitua por nul